> > Are there any farcry plugins (jQuery) to do form field validation and
> something to stop spambots (prefrably) not captcha based?
>
> You can use the form protection built into FarCry Core.  Just add
> bSpamProtect="true" to your processform.cfm tag to enable
> cfformprotection.  Go to the Admin > Configs > Form Protection config
> to adjust how this behaviour works.
